Definition
The series of molecular signals initiated by a ligand binding to a vascular endothelial growth factor receptor (VEGFR) on the surface of the target cell, and ending with the regulation of a downstream cellular process, e.g. transcription.Source: GOC:signaling,GOC:ceb
Comment
In GO, a gene product with 'vascular endothelial growth factor-activated receptor activity ; GO:0005021' necessarily binds VEGF to transduce a signal. In contrast, the VEGFR refers to PR:000001971. To represent cross-talk between ligands and receptors, signaling pathways in GO are starting to be named after the receptor and/or the signal. GO:0048010 is for annotation of any pathway in which a ligand (VEGF or an alternative growth factor) binds and activates a VEGFR (PR:000001971). For annotation of signaling pathways where a VEGF binds to a cell surface receptor (VEGFR, PDGFR etc.), consider 'vascular endothelial growth factor signaling pathway ; GO:0038084'.
